# Configuration subroutine to validate and canonicalize a configuration type.
29
# Supply the specified configuration type as an argument.
30
# If it is invalid, we print an error message on stderr and exit with code 1.
31
# Otherwise, we print the canonical config type on stdout and succeed.
32
 
33
# This file is supposed to be the same for all GNU packages
34
# and recognize all the CPU types, system types and aliases
35
# that are meaningful with *any* GNU software.
36
# Each package is responsible for reporting which valid configurations
37
# it does not support.  The user should be able to distinguish
38
# a failure to support a valid configuration from a meaningless
39
# configuration.
40
 
41
# The goal of this file is to map all the various variations of a given
42
# machine specification into a single specification in the form:
43
#       CPU_TYPE-MANUFACTURER-OPERATING_SYSTEM
44
# or in some cases, the newer four-part form:
45
#       CPU_TYPE-MANUFACTURER-KERNEL-OPERATING_SYSTEM
46
# It is wrong to echo any other type of specification.
